When David Caplan and David Gross started Dolbeau, a just-launched line of neckwear, it was based on three simple principles: Local manufacturing, high-quality handmade goods and easy online customization. The result is an easy-to-use website that allows you to choose from a wide range of ties (both traditional and bow ties) and tailor them to your taste. The two-tone ties—ideal for sporting a little sprezzatura—can be ordered in three widths, with your choice of tips (standard, flat or dagger) and in lengths ranging from 54 to 66 inches. The bow ties are reversible and also come in three styles with your choice of buttons (might we suggest the leather?). The debut label is hard at work on some ties cut from rich suiting wools due out later this fall and recently finished the work on a collaboration with local Montreal shop Rooney, which has just hit the store's shelves.
